Like Bitcoin, Ether operates on its own blockchain—but unlike Bitcoin, Ether is uncapped, meaning that an infinite number of coins can. A digital coin is created on its own blockchain and acts in much the same way as traditional money. It can be used to store value and as a means of exchange.
